Amplify your look by pairing a little bling with your sexy, strapless black evening gown. When it comes to necklaces, you can go short and sophisticated, or long and luscious -- depending on how you want to accessorize your look. Peek at your shoes, bag, shrug and other jewelry you plan to wear with the dress. Do they scream Hollywood glammed-up hottie or vivacious vintage babe? These visual cues will help you choose that last piece of sparkle for your outfit.
Collar and Choker Necklaces
Necklaces that rest above the neckline of your strapless gown won't compete with the style of your dress. If the bodice of your dress dazzles with sequins, embroidery or sewn-on bling, choose a collar or choker-style necklace. The Victorian mystique of a triple stand of white pearls on a 12- to 13-inch collar necklace radiates elegance against a black strapless dress. For a bit more breathing room and a modern appeal, choose a silver herringbone choker.
Mid-Length Necklace Options
If your black strapless dress has a seductive sweetheart neckline, wear your favorite princess-length -- 17- to 19-inch -- necklace. Add a little glitz to a simple gown by choosing a necklace with a diamond or rhinestone pendant. You'll sparkle! For a more subdued look, wear a silver locket pendant or a string of black Tahitian pearls.
Long Necklace Ideas
Make the focus of your ensemble your necklace. Choose a long 20- to 24-inch matinee necklace, a 28- to 34-inch opera necklace or an ultra sexy rope necklace that measures in at 45 inches. Choose these extra-long necklace lengths when you want your shoes and other jewelry to melt into the background and all eyes to focus on your torso. A string of glass beads or a woven gold chain necklace will shimmer against your black strapless dress.
Layering Ideas
If simple and sleek isn't your normal look, try layering multiple necklaces. Pair two rope necklaces together by tying them into a loose knot at the front of your gown for a modern look. Extra-long rope necklaces can also be looped around your neck twice -- giving the appearance of a combination choker and opera-length necklace. For a stunning touch of glitter on your decolletage, layer a dozen simple gold or silver princess-length chains.
